    Default Regular release of BotCon 2011 comic & competition

    Fun Publications (with a new logo that copies a bit of the Hasbro 'smile' logo) have released details of their non-convention print of their BotCon 2011 comic.
    (each one is released through comic stores a few months after the convention each year)

    This year, they are adding in 16 pages of extra content... but that's not the only incentive this time.

    (this was a bit confusing, so hopefully I figured it out)
    It sounds like there are several prizes for customers who pre-order and receive the most copies (they have to email funpub and provide proof), while the comic store that orders the most copies will also win a prize pack (to do with as they please).

    The Customer prizes:
    Grand prize - the Minerva toy
    First prize (wouldn't this be second prize if the Grand prize is First?) - TF3 Gaming Mouse & Mouse Pad
    Runner-up - (5) signed copy of the comic.

    The comic store prize pack - signed copy of the comic, a Fisitron toy, and a TF3 Gaming Mouse.

    To pre-order a copy, or to try to win a prize, head on down to your comic store while September Previews is available. The comic appears on page 298.


    At US$8 per comic, I wonder how many people will be buying dozens of copies to try to get Minerva... and end up not winning anything (or ending up with a runner-up prize of another copy of the comic).

    (when this is released, there will be such a flood of cheap copies on ebay from all the people who tried to get Minerva)
